Driving with a Trailer
1 CAUTION:
If you have a rear-most window open and you
pull a trailer with your vehicle, carbon nlonoxide
(CO) could corne into your vehicle. You can’t see
or smell CO. It can cause unconsciousness or
death. (See “Engine Exhaust” in the Index.)
To
maximize your safety when towing a trailer:
Have your exhaust system inspected for
leaks, and make necessary repairs before
starting
on your trip.
Keep the rear-most windows closed.
If exhaust does come into your vehicle
through a window in the rear or another
opening, drive with your front, main
heating
or cooling system on and with the
fan on any speed.
This will bring fresh,
outside air into your vehicle. Do not use
MAX AX because it only recirculates the
air inside your vehicle. (See “ Comfort
Controls” in the Index.)

Turn Signals When Towing a Trailer
4-51
Page 217 of 410

When towing a trailer, the ~~rrows on your instrument
panel
will flash for turns even if the bulbs on the trailer
itre burned out. Thus. you may think drivers behind you
are seeing your signal when they are not. It's important
to check occasionally to be sure the trailer bulbs arc
still working.
Driving On Grades
On a long uphill grade, shift down and reducc your
speed
to around 45 mph (70 km/h) to reduce the
possibility
of engine and transmission ovc.rheating.
If you have an automatic transmission. you should use
DRIVE
(D) when towing a trailer. Operating your
vehicle
in DRIVE (D) when towing a trailer will
minimize heat buildup and extend the life
of your
trrmsmission. Or:
if you have ;1 manual transmission. it's
better not to use FIFTH (5) gear. just drive in
FOURTH (4) gear (or, as you need to, a I~MW gear). Whcn
towins at high altitude
on steep uphill grades,
consider the following: Engine coolant will boil at a
lower temperature than at normal altitudes. If yo^^ turn
your engine off immediately after towing
at high altitude
on steep uphill grades, your \:ellicle may show signs
similar to engine overheating.
To avoid this. let the
engine
r~~n while parked (preferably on level grout1d)
with the automatic transmission in PARK (Pj (or the
1manuaI transmission out of
gear and the parking brake
applied) 1'01-
;I few minutes before turning the engine off.
If you do get the overheat warning. see "Engine
Overheating"
in the Index.

When You Are Ready to Leave After
Parking on
a Hill
I, Apply your reg~~lar brakes and lwld the pedal down
while you:
Start your engine;
Shift into a gear: and
Release the parking brake.
2. Let up on the brake pedal.
3. Drive slowly until the trailer is clear of the chocks.
4. Stop and have someone pick up and store the chocks.
Maintenance When Trailer Towing
Your vehicle will need service nlore often when you're
pulling a trailer. See the Maintenance Schedule for more
on
this. Things that are especially important in trailer
operation
are automatic transmission fluid (don't
overfill), engine
oil. ~~xle lubricant, belt, cooling system
and
brakc adjustment. Each of these is covered in this
manurd.
and the Index will help you find then] quickly.
If you're trailering. it's a good idea to review these
sections before you start your trip.
Check periodically
to see that all hitch nuts and bolts
are tight.

If No Steam Is Coming From Your Engine
If you zet the overheat warning but see or hear no
steam. the problem may not be too serious. Sometimes
the engine can get
a little too hot when you:
0 Climb a long hill on a hot day.
Stop after high-speed driving.
Idle for long periods in traffic.
Tow a trailer. See "Driving on Grades" in the Index.
If you get the overheat warning with no sign of steam,
try this for a minute
or so:
2. T~11-11 on yo~~r heater to full hot at the highest fan
speed and open the window as necessary.
3. If you're in a traffic jam. shift to NEUTRAL (N):
otherwise, shift to the highest gear \vhile
driving -- AUTOMATIC OVERDRIVE ((33) or
DRIVE (D) for automatic transmissions.
If you no longer have the overheat warning. you
can drive. Just
to be safe. drive slower for about
10 minutes. If the warning doesn't come back on.
you can drive norrnally.
If the warning continues. pull over, stop, and park your
vehicle right away.
If there's still no sign of steam. push the accelerator until
the engine speed is about twice as fast as normal idle
speed. Bring the engine speed back
to normal idle speed
after two or three minutes. Now see
if the warning stops.
But then, if you still have the warning, rum ogtlw
eugine
c~l got el?er;\.olw out oftlw \vl~iclc. until it
cools down.
You
may decide not to lift the hood but to get service
help right
away.

This vehicle has a clutched engine cooling fan. When
the clutch is engaged,
the fan spins faster to provide
more air to cool the engine.
In most everyday driving
conditions, the clutch
is not engaged. This improves
fuel economy and reduces
fan noise. Under heavy
vehicle loading, trailer towing and/or high outside
temperatures, the
fan speed increases when the clutch
engages.
So you may hear an increase in fan noise. This
is normal and should not be mistaken as the
transmission slipping
or making extra shifts. It is merely
the cooling system functioning properly. The fan will
slow down when additional cooling is not required and
the clutch disengages.
You
may also hear this fan noise when you start he
engine.
It will go away as the fan clutch disengages. It's
unusual
for a tire to "blow out" while you're driving,
especially
if you maintain your tires properly. If air goes
out of
a tire, it's muc11 more likely to leak out slowly.
But if you should ever have a "blowout." here are a few
tips about what
to expect and what to do:
If a front tire fails, the flat tire will create a drag that
pulls the vehicle toward that side. Take your foot off the
accelerator pedal and grip the steering wheel firmly.
Steer to ~naintain lane position, and then gently brake to
a stop well out of the traffic lane.
A rear blowout. particularly on a curve, acts much like a
skid and may require the same correction you'd use in a
skid. In any rear blowout, remove yo~~r foot from the
accelerator pedal. Get the c.ehicle under control
by
steering the way ~OLI want the vehicle to go. It may be
very bumpy
and noisy. but you can still steer. Gently
brake to
a stop -- well off the road if possible.
